Former Pakistan cricket team captain Shahid Afridi has welcomed the accountability of former DG ISI Lieutenant General (retd) Faiz Hameed, calling it a positive step and urging that all individuals who harmed the country should be held accountable, while also praising the Pakistan Army for initiating accountability within its own ranks and expressing pride in the institution; speaking in Karachi, Afridi also termed the addition of two new teams to the Pakistan Super League (PSL) as a positive move that will create more opportunities for players, highlighted the PSL as Pakistan’s growing global brand, and stressed that the national cricket team should now be finalized for the upcoming World Cup without unnecessary experimentation.
